Sat 1499315475287146

decimal
389726.475287146
degree
0°179726′638″475287146‴
percentile
71.39597509220923%
name
dfpldvlxavf
cycle
0
epoch
1
period
193
block
389726
offset
475287146
timestamp
rarity
common